STM 350 / STM 350U Dolphin Temperature and Humidity Sensor Module
The document describes the STM 350 and STM 350U temperature and humidity sensor modules from Dolphin. The modules use energy harvesting and wireless communication via EnOcean radio. They contain an onboard temperature and humidity sensor and solar cell power source, and can operate for over 10 days without light by using an optional backup battery.

Features overview
Antenna 50 Ohm helix antenna (on-board)
Radio Frequency / Data Rate STM 350 868.3 MHz ASK / 125 kbps STM 350U 902.875 FSK / 125 kbps Radiated Output Power (typ.) +5 dBm On-board Power Supply Pre-installed solar cell Auxiliary Power Supply Option for backup battery (3V) 1) Operation time in darkness @ 25°C min. 10 days, if energy storage fully charged Sensor performance Temperature: ±0.5 K across entire range Humidity: ±3.0 % r.h. between 20 … 80 % r.h. Measurement interval Approximately once every 100 s Transmission interval Every 7 … 14 measurements (affected at random) Immediate transmission in case of significant change EnOcean Equipment Profile (EEP) A5-04-03 SIGNAL 0x06 (Energy Level Reporting) SIGNAL 0x0E (Entering Transport Mode) Operating and Storage temperature Absolute Maximum: -20 °C … +60 °C Recommended1: +10 °C…+30 °C Shelf life (in absolute darkness) 36 months after delivery2) 1
Operating and storage humidity Maximum: 0% … 93% r.h., non-condensing
Recommended: < 60% r.h. Dimensions 50±0.2 x 16±0.3 x 10mm 1 Energy storage performance degrades over life time, especially if energy storage is long time exposed to very high temperatures. High temperatures will accelerate aging. Very low temperature will temporary reduce capacity of energy store and this leads to considerable shorter dark time operation. 2 Deep discharge of the energy storage leads to degradation of performance. Therefore products have to be taken into operation after 36 months.
